Transaction 1dbf76ea8392324d6975814b0bea912e1f03eb4e16bbb72973c9c5157db4751a
2 Input
2 Outputs
- 1dbf76ea8392324d6975814b0bea912e1f03eb4e16bbb72973c9c5157db4751a:0
- 1dbf76ea8392324d6975814b0bea912e1f03eb4e16bbb72973c9c5157db4751a:1
value 23629900
address 16DkVdTsW6PPeK7EweTGro6ddfiZgLe3xR
value 995523
address 1NRTxXJv8N6UXrbXJys9uP6zReDcx3iLc6